Pauline Murray made an indelible mark on the early UK punk scene with Penetration, whose 1977 single “Don’t Dictate” remains one of the era’s defining releases. Known for their electrifying live performances, the band released two acclaimed albums, Moving Targets and Coming Up For Air, before disbanding in 1979.
In recent years, Murray has embraced more intimate acoustic performances, showcasing the depth of her songwriting and the distinctive strength of her voice. These stripped-back shows inspired her 2020 solo album Elemental, while her 2023 autobiography Life’s A Gamble offers a candid reflection on a remarkable musical journey.
